Joerg Sonnenberger
962713f68a
Split a comment into generic description and note about the specific
...
cmake use.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@283027 91177308-0d34-0410-b5e6-96231b3b80d8
2016-10-01 08:05:50 +00:00
Joerg Sonnenberger
1839f8accb
Retire LLVM_BINDIR and friends. They haven't been provided with actual
...
values since the switch to cmake.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@283026 91177308-0d34-0410-b5e6-96231b3b80d8
2016-10-01 08:03:55 +00:00
Joerg Sonnenberger
83660ff710
GC HAVE_STRTOQ
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@283023 91177308-0d34-0410-b5e6-96231b3b80d8
2016-10-01 07:35:08 +00:00
Joerg Sonnenberger
a27efcd029
Retire bugpoint's -R. hack.
...
It got disconnected during the cmake conversion. For Miscompilation.cpp,
it was purely advisory for the user and the ToolRunner.cpp version was
trying to compensate for libs and bins in the same directory, which
hasn't been the case for a very long time.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@283022 91177308-0d34-0410-b5e6-96231b3b80d8
2016-10-01 07:34:18 +00:00
Joerg Sonnenberger
e68f1f14f3
Sort LLVM_VERSION_INFO
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282939 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:34:02 +00:00
Joerg Sonnenberger
d79cc3deb4
GC left-over from workarounds for missing pid_t and size_t
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282938 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:32:42 +00:00
Joerg Sonnenberger
be24edeca0
GC ENABLE_PIC
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282936 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:30:25 +00:00
Joerg Sonnenberger
dd9e07b78a
GC HAVE___DSO_HANDLE
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282935 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:29:19 +00:00
Joerg Sonnenberger
11c0597db0
Correctly expand HOST_LINK_VERSION.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282934 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:28:42 +00:00
Joerg Sonnenberger
37e039ee13
Fix expansion of HAVE_SYS_MMAN_H
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282933 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:27:41 +00:00
Joerg Sonnenberger
93ae5d5aab
GC HAVE_LINK_EXPORT_DYNAMIC.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282932 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:26:31 +00:00
Joerg Sonnenberger
051cae622f
GC HAVE_MMAP and HAVE_MMAP_FILE
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282931 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:24:54 +00:00
Joerg Sonnenberger
513fcd69de
Spell comment consistently with other library comments.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282930 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:24:21 +00:00
Joerg Sonnenberger
e3674fa34c
Sort LINK_POLLY_INTO_TOOLS.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282929 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:21:35 +00:00
Joerg Sonnenberger
d851cd598a
GC STDC_HEADERS.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282928 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:19:02 +00:00
Joerg Sonnenberger
593505d39e
Deal with the (historic) MAP_ANONYMOUS vs MAP_ANON directly by using CPP
...
to check for the former, don't depend on (dangling) HAVE_MMAP_ANONYMOUS.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282925 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:17:23 +00:00
Joerg Sonnenberger
f1086ea04d
Retire NEED_DEV_ZERO_FOR_MMAP. It should be needed only on outdated
...
systems. It wasn't even hooked up in cmake, so problems on such systems
would be visible with 3.9 release already.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282924 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:16:01 +00:00
Joerg Sonnenberger
b540020e6b
GC HAVE_LIBDL, HAVE_LIBM and HAVE_LIBOLE32
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282922 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:09:45 +00:00
Joerg Sonnenberger
c4ff9fbd85
Sort HAVE_LIBEDIT.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282921 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:08:36 +00:00
Joerg Sonnenberger
d8588ac73f
Turn ENABLE_CRASH_OVERRIDES into a 0/1 definition.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282919 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:06:19 +00:00
Joerg Sonnenberger
2bf78b4d6c
Convert ENABLE_BACKTRACES into a 0/1 definition.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282918 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 20:04:24 +00:00
Joerg Sonnenberger
2e683f12dc
GC TIME_WITH_SYS_TIME and TM_IN_SYS_TIME
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282917 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 19:59:58 +00:00
Joerg Sonnenberger
f39b9e0db5
GC STAT_MACROS_BROKEN.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282915 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 19:58:44 +00:00
Joerg Sonnenberger
8a2343b89e
GC NEED_USCORE.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282914 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 19:57:54 +00:00
Joerg Sonnenberger
9172a948f1
Turn LLVM_USE_OPROFILE into a 0/1 definition.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282909 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 19:55:37 +00:00
Joerg Sonnenberger
9ca7d0850f
Turn LLVM_USE_INTEL_JITEVENTS into a 0/1 definition.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282908 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 19:54:25 +00:00
Joerg Sonnenberger
189d5c4135
Turn LLVM_ENABLE_ABI_BREAKING_CHECKS into a 0/1 definition like
...
LLVM_ENABLE_THREADS. Include llvm-config.h explicitly in headers to make
sure that the definition is available.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282907 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-30 19:52:27 +00:00
Joerg Sonnenberger
d4dee422c4
GC HAVE_STRDUP.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282793 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:50:37 +00:00
Joerg Sonnenberger
5673d4cfd9
GC more left-over libtool defines.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282791 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:47:34 +00:00
Joerg Sonnenberger
6506cd61ad
GC HAVE_PRINTF_A, HAVE_STD_ISINF_IN_CMATH and HAVE_STD_ISNAN_IN_CMATH
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282789 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:45:45 +00:00
Joerg Sonnenberger
224b8e4d46
HAVE_DIA_SDK is directly checked by value, so define it as 0/1.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282788 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:44:25 +00:00
Joerg Sonnenberger
ac9b3d6062
Move _chsize_s and _Unwind_Backtrace to the correct position.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282786 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:42:36 +00:00
Joerg Sonnenberger
3d4be77c11
Fix HAVE_POSIX_FALLOCATE entry.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282785 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:39:53 +00:00
Joerg Sonnenberger
a9d83e2e34
Fix comments to match autoconf.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282784 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:39:11 +00:00
Joerg Sonnenberger
d067fa4b2d
GC HAVE_DLD.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282783 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:37:46 +00:00
Joerg Sonnenberger
00d1c969ed
GC HAVE_DYLD, HAVE_PRELOADED_SYMBOLS and HAVE_SHL_LOAD
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282782 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:35:27 +00:00
Joerg Sonnenberger
4f08643ad0
Sort mallctl, fix comment for mallinfo.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282781 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:33:53 +00:00
Joerg Sonnenberger
87632b415d
GC HAVE_DLERROR.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282780 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:32:30 +00:00
Joerg Sonnenberger
74f466a640
GC srand48/lrand48/drand48.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282779 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:31:54 +00:00
Joerg Sonnenberger
eb7b0d7038
GC HAVE_BCOPY.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282778 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:30:23 +00:00
Joerg Sonnenberger
46cb71157f
GC opendir/readdir/closedir checks.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282776 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:29:57 +00:00
Joerg Sonnenberger
b551157e44
GC HAVE_SETJMP_H and checks for the content of setjmp.h.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282775 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:28:37 +00:00
Joerg Sonnenberger
e7d6d31948
Sort futimes correctly.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282773 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:19:43 +00:00
Joerg Sonnenberger
d72397ae5e
Check for sysconf(3).
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282772 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:18:05 +00:00
Joerg Sonnenberger
04e8656779
GC HAVE_MACH_O_DYLD_H.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282771 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:15:57 +00:00
Joerg Sonnenberger
fe86503537
GC HAVE_UTIME_H.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282770 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:15:23 +00:00
Joerg Sonnenberger
248a030bf9
GC HAVE_LIMITS_H.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282769 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:14:34 +00:00
Joerg Sonnenberger
5a47084235
Make HAVE_DECL_ARC4RANDOM always defined. Sort the entry correctly.
...
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282768 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:10:38 +00:00
Joerg Sonnenberger
422655d988
HAVE_UNWIND_BACKTRACE -> HAVE__UNWIND_BACKTRACE
...
Check for existance and not truth value.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282767 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:07:57 +00:00
Joerg Sonnenberger
f98f3575ee
Remove LLVM_CONFIGTIME, left-overs from when reproducable builds where
...
not the default.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@282765 91177308-0d34-0410-b5e6-96231b3b80d8
2016-09-29 21:00:53 +00:00